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United KingdomWe stayed in the McMillan suite, the bed is extremely loud to the extent that it wakes you up turning over in the night. It's a beautiful looking bed and very comfortable but very loud, squeaky and creaks with a small movement, it needs tightening up, the floor above was also extremely noisy just walking around but it's so squeaky, our whole room was the same. The floor boards need something done to them as from 6am the people upstairs were walking around and it was so loud it woke me and my husband, I'm a heavy sleeper but did not sleep well due to the noise. The shower was either freezing cold or boiling hot there was no in the middle temperature. More than Half the sockets in the room couldn't be used as weren't British, there was more American style sockets than British. Downstairs the hotel looked amazing but upstairs where the rooms were very tired looking, carpets very worn, door frames needed painting.
It's a beautiful hotel and the staff in the restaurant were fantastic. We stayed here for a wedding and the staff were so accommodating and friendly. The grounds are beautiful and so is the hotel, I'd highly recommend staying here, very good value for money.

United KingdomParts of the property are quite worn and need upgrading. I found the beds very hard and uncomfortable. Some of the public areas needed better cleaning - parts of the bar area needed a good dust. Behind Reception looked really dirty and shabby. My safe wouldn’t work and I was just told the batteries were probably flat. Hardly any toilet paper in room initially. Small niggles but not what you expect in a former very prestigious hotel. Large off -putting stain beside bed. Windows difficult to open and close. Window in original room dirty and mouldy and only opened from the bottom on to grass and woods - so I was too nervous to have the window open.
Great location for my needs. I was unhappy with my room because of security issues and was upgraded to a better room at no extra cost which was very much appreciated. The waitresses in particular were just great, helpful, smiley and warm.
